    World and nation religion briefs  May 8, 2009
    (AP) ---- The Southern Baptist Theological Seminary is folding its decades-old music school into another school because of the sluggish economy and waning popularity with students. The seminary's School of Church Music and Worship has trained thousands of choir directors, organists and other church worship leaders for 65 years. (North County Times)
